Las Vegas Grand Prix 2023: Max Verstappen Bags 18th Win In Spirited Formula One Race - In Pics

Red Bull Racing driver Max Verstappen won his 18th race of the season on Sunday with a pass of Charles Leclerc at the Las Vegas Grand Prix 2023, which turned out to be one of the most competitive events of the season despite a disastrous start to Formula One's expensive extravaganza. “Viva Las Vegas! Viva Las Vegas!” sang the three-time reigning world champion as he crossed under the checkered flag waved by Justin Bieber. Verstappen had slammed the race at every chance, yet raced in an Elvis-inspired firesuit and took the victory on the famed Las Vegas Strip. Verstappen, Leclerc and Sergio Perez were driven in a limousine to a podium located near the Bellagio — "we go straight to the nightclub,” Verstappen told his fellow podium finishers — but they were instead treated to the casino's famed fountain show.
